How much do telecom sales consultant j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 13, 2026, the average yearly pay for telecom sales consultant in the United States is $59,000.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$52,500.00 and $65,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a telecommunications consultant do?

A telecommunications consultant advises organizations on designing, implementing, and managing communication systems such as phone networks, internet services, and data transmission. They analyze client needs, recommend suitable technologies, and often assist with system integration and troubleshooting, requiring strong technical knowledge and communication skills.

What are Telecom Sales Consultants?

Telecom Sales Consultants are professionals who specialize in selling telecommunications products and services, such as phone systems, internet packages, and network solutions, to businesses or individual customers. They assess clients' needs, recommend suitable solutions, and negotiate contracts to close sales. In addition to product knowledge, Telecom Sales Consultants often provide ongoing customer support and help clients optimize their communication services. Their role requires strong communication, negotiation, and technical skills. Success in this job often depends on meeting sales targets and building long-term client relationships.

How does a Telecom Sales Consultant typically collaborate with technical teams to deliver solutions for clients?

Telecom Sales Consultants work closely with technical teams, such as network engineers and solution architects, to ensure that the products and services offered meet client requirements. During the sales process, consultants gather and communicate customer needs, coordinate product demonstrations, and help tailor solutions to fit unique business challenges. This collaborative approach not only helps in building trust with clients but also ensures the proposed solutions are technically sound and feasible. Effective communication and teamwork are key to successfully closing deals and maintaining client satisfaction.

Both roles focus on selling telecom products and services, often requiring similar credentials and industry knowledge. The main difference is that Telecom Sales Consultants typically work on generating new business and providing technical advice, while Telecom Account Executives manage ongoing client relationships and upselling.
